HTML: eliminar a: hover para imágenes?

portexto enlaces, tengo:

CSS:

a:link {color: #3366a9; text-decoration: none}
a:hover {border-bottom: 1px solid; color: black}

Pero esto también añade un subrayado negro en linkableIMGs que yo no quiero

¿Cómo elimino elborder-bottom en IMGs enlazables cuando se desplaza con CSS?

He intentado lo siguiente:

a:hover img {border-bottom: 0px}

Pero eso no funciona

Ejemplo vivo (intenta desplazarse sobre el logotipo en la parte superior izquierda)

Respuestas a la pregunta(7)

Su respuesta a la pregunta